Useful article about colourblindness (Colour vision deficiency) from the NHS
The NHS have useful information on their website about colourblindness, including information on; an explanation of what it is; types and symptoms of colour vision deficiency; tests for colour vision deficiency; issues for people with a colour vision deficiency; causes of colour vision deficiency; how colour vision deficiency is inherited.
